Pre-existing medical conditions are among the most common bases for insurance company arguments to reduce personal injury claim values. Understanding how California law addresses this issue, and how proper documentation responds to it, is essential for any claimant with a prior medical history in the area of their accident-related injuries.California recognizes the eggshell plaintiff doctrine, which holds defendants responsible for the full extent of harm caused, even if a pre-existing vulnerability contributed to the severity of the injury. This doctrine prevents defendants from reducing liability by pointing to a claimant’s prior medical fragility.How to Distinguish Aggravation From Pre-Existing InjuryThe key…

Accidents are distressing, especially when another person drives your car. Understanding your rights and responsibilities is crucial. If someone crashes your car, the aftermath can leave you feeling anxious and uncertain. You might worry about insurance, liability, and financial impact. Importantly, you need to know who pays for damages and how it affects your insurance. Typically, insurance follows the car, not the driver. This means your insurance often covers the accident, but there are exceptions. The driver’s insurance might come into play if your coverage doesn’t fully address the damages. Division of Assets Property and Asset Distribution Property and asset distribution is a significant component of any separation agreement. This section clarifies how shared assets like the family home, vehicles, and other valuable property are to be divided between the separating partners. Under Ontario’s property division laws, each partner’s net family property is assessed to determine who owes whom a compensatory payment, called an “equalization payment.” Key assets to consider include: Family Home: Known as the matrimonial home, this property is subject to special rules in Ontario. Defining Birth Injuries and Their Causes Birth injuries refer to physical harm or trauma that occurs to a baby during the process of labor and delivery. These injuries can range from minor, such as bruising or swelling, to severe, potentially resulting in long-term disabilities or developmental issues. Causes of Birth Injuries: Complications during labor and delivery Prolonged labor Premature birth Medical negligence Improper use of delivery tools It is crucial for parents to understand that birth injuries are not always preventable. If you’ve suffered harm in an accident caused by negligence or misconduct, you may be legally entitled to monetary compensation. Two main damage categories apply in personal injury cases – compensatory and punitive. Each type serves a specific purpose and is calculated differently.
